Job Description

About PepsiCo

PepsiCo is one of the world's leading food and beverage companies, with an extensive portfolio that includes iconic brands like Pepsi, Lay's, Gatorade, and Quaker. Operating in over 200 countries, PepsiCo employs more than 300,000 people globally and is committed to sustainable growth, innovation, and delivering consumer-pleasing products. In Russia, PepsiCo has a strong presence with state-of-the-art facilities focused on dairy, snacks, and beverages, driving category leadership through cutting-edge product development.

Role Overview

As a Junior Product Development Engineer at PepsiCo's Moscow Lianozovo facility, you will play a pivotal role in innovating traditional dairy products. This entry-level position offers hands-on experience in developing fermented dairy projects, managing technical documentation, and leading pilot tests. Ideal for motivated graduates in food science or related fields, this role combines technical expertise with cross-functional collaboration in a dynamic food industry environment. Join PepsiCo to contribute to high-impact projects that shape the future of dairy innovation in Russia.

Key Responsibilities

Your day-to-day will involve a blend of technical development and project leadership:

  • Develop dairy projects specifically for traditional dairy product categories, ensuring alignment with market needs and quality standards.
  • Lead Productivity initiatives, Business Continuity plans, and Technical Brand Stewardship to maintain operational excellence.
  • Approve and update critical technical documentation, including product recipes, raw material specifications, and technical regulations compliant with EAEU standards.
  • Prepare technical information for packaging labels and execute technological trials both on production lines and in the pilot workshop.
  • Conduct research under quality improvement programs to enhance product performance and consumer satisfaction.
  • Participate actively in cross-functional meetings to discuss project statuses and strategies for modern fermented product platforms.
  • Lead pilot and industrial tests to design innovative products and optimize production technologies.

Qualifications & Requirements

To succeed in this role, you should bring:

  • A higher education degree in Food Science, Chemistry, Microbiology, or Engineering.
  • Knowledge and experience in fermented dairy product technologies as a strong advantage.
  • High motivation and a flexible approach to working in cross-functional teams.
  • Proficiency in HACCP principles, technical legislation, and Technical Regulations of the Eurasian Economic Union (TR EAEU).
  • English language skills at pre-intermediate level or higher, with a commitment to further improvement.
  • Strong presentation skills, both written and oral, for effective communication.

No prior extensive experience is required, but enthusiasm for food innovation and teamwork is essential.
